Latest update resets all settings

I am furious, so I thought I'd pass along this warning to be careful performing the latest update from Apple for your Apple TV. The latest update tonight completely reset all of my settings. Every password, screen saver, time zone, standby, wifi setting was gone. Everything. It's like setting up your Apple TV for the first time. Only now you get to reconfigure everything you've tweaked over the many months all at once.


Definitely don't perform this update if you intend to watch something right now. You'll be out of commission for 30-45 minutes scrolling and clicking everything back to the way it was.

Yes. Apparently before I update my Apple TV I should go online and check with them. Probably wouldn't have updated, given that it doesn't look like the update really did much for me.


It was when the update went from 4.2 or 4.3 (I don't remember which I had) to 4.4. Then right after that there was another update, to 4.4.4. That one, fortunately, didn't cremate my settings.


But like I said, the update doesn't appear to do anything. I haven't really had any problems with Netflix or iTunes purchases in months, and I've never had any network connectivity issues with wifi streaming movies from my MacMini. Maybe they are fixes that are more appropriate for Windows users.
